How to read this Delta Technical College-Mississippi profile

Figures above come from IPEDS institution records published through the College Scorecard (retrieved July 2026 for institution fields; March 2026 for field-of-study). Peer groups and cost cohorts follow IPEDS ownership sector, Carnegie class, and locale, not an editorial shortlist.

Average net price subtracts grant and scholarship aid from cost of attendance for full-time, first-time undergraduate Title IV recipients. It is a defined cohort average, not a personalized price; income-band fields add context but do not replace the school's current net-price calculator.

Earnings use Treasury-linked records for federally aided former students who were working and not enrolled in the measurement year (completers and noncompleters). IPEDS completion and retention use separate first-time, full-time cohorts, so those denominators are not the earnings cohort. Read cost, completion, and earnings as distinct historical measures, not a causal verdict or individual forecast.

Net price at Delta Technical College-Mississippi swings rather than trends

Across 11 reported years between 2013 and 2023, the average net price here has ranged from $14,420 to $25,303 without settling into a rise or a fall. Comparing only the first and last years would read as -19.5%, but the years in between do not follow that line, so the honest summary is the range rather than a trend. Budget against the upper end, not the average.

Program Credential Completers Median Earnings Median Debt
Precision Metal Working Certificate 122 $47,321 $9,500
Environmental Control Technologies/Technicians Certificate 173 $45,679 $9,500
Ground Transportation Certificate 652 $40,840 $6,333
Electrical and Power Transmission Installers Certificate 57 $40,547 $9,500
Health and Medical Administrative Services Certificate 26 $34,048 $9,500
Allied Health and Medical Assisting Services Certificate 271 $31,629 $9,500
Dental Support Services and Allied Professions Certificate 125 $29,448 $9,500
Cosmetology and Related Personal Grooming Services Certificate 81 $23,066 $11,450

How much do Delta Technical College-Mississippi former students earn?
Federally aided former students at Delta Technical College-Mississippi who were working and not enrolled had median earnings of $33,601 ten years after entry; the cohort is not limited to graduates. Six years after entry, the corresponding median is $30,633.

Is Delta Technical College-Mississippi worth the student debt?
The median student debt at Delta Technical College-Mississippi is $9,500, while former students earn a median of $33,601 ten years after enrollment. That debt represents about 28% of those annual earnings. Among borrowers who completed their program, 31.4% are repaying their loans within 3 years. Estimated monthly loan payment is $101.
